What does it mean to say that a number is a perfect square? Give one example of a number that is a perfect square and one that i
likoan [24]
In mathematics, a square number or perfect square is an integer that is the square of an integer; in other words, it is the product of some integer with itself. For example, 9 is a square number, since it can be written as 3 × 3. 16 is a perfect square and 10 is not a perfect square
